Right now, there is a brisk market for used analog UHF and VHF narrowband compliant radios, both mobiles and portables. You are right that there is a lot of used gear coming available because many agencies moved to 700/800 or one of the VHF or UHF digital technologies. But, just as many agencies have simply replaced non-compliant analog gear with compliant analog gear so there is a scramble to scoop up this used gear, especially by folks that own their own radios to match what their departments have done.
I suspect you may see prices for used compliant stuff remain up a bit for quite a while to come. Right now I am on the lookout for Motorola CDM750's or CM200's in VHF, both 40 watt and 25 watt models. Used ones are selling for right around $150 each WITHOUT mic, mounting bracket, or power cable. If the accessories are present, most of them are selling for $175 to $190 depending on age and condition.
